The Duvall-Edison housing market is very competitive. The median sale price of a home in Duvall-Edison was $269K last month, up 39.4% since last year. The median sale price per square foot in Duvall-Edison is $194, up 37.6% since last year.
What is the housing market like in Duvall-Edison today?
In March 2024, Duvall-Edison home prices were up 39.4% compared to last year, selling for a median price of $269K. On average, homes in Duvall-Edison sell after 6 days on the market compared to 25 days last year. There were 9 homes sold in March this year, up from 4 last year.

How hot is the Duvall-Edison housing market?
Duvall-Edison is very competitive. Homes sell in 8 days.

The Redfin Compete Score rates how competitive an area is on a scale of 0 to 100, where 100 is the most competitive.
Calculated over the last 9 months
Many homes get multiple offers, some with waived contingencies.
The average homes sell for about 1% above list price and go pending in around 8 days.

Duvall-Edison has a minor risk of flooding. 58 properties in Duvall-Edison are likely to be
severely affected
by flooding over the next 30 years. This represents 13% of all properties in Duvall-Edison. Flood risk is increasing slower than the national average.

Duvall-Edison has a Minimal Wind Factor®, which means there is a very low likelihood that hurricane, tornado or severe storm winds will impact this area.
